About Adventure Tourism Management in Aberystwyth University

Are you interested in gaining a greater understanding in one of the fastest growing sectors of the UK? Then our BSc Adventure Tourism Management degree at Aberystwyth University is you.

This degree is engineered to enable you to unlock and develop skills in the business, marketing and management of adventure tourism operations. You will also learn in a stimulating environment and study in a location where the opportunities for adventure are unparalleled, allowing you to understand this young industry in its development.

Academic qualification equivalents:

  • We generally accept minimum 75% in year XII Std. of the Centeral Board of Secondary Education and the Council for the Indian School Certificate Examination, in addition to the state boards of education in India.

English language requirements (one of the below):

  • IELTS          :         6.0 with minimum 5.5 in each component
  • TOEFL         :         88 with minimum component scores: Reading 18, Listening 17, Speaking 20, Writing 17. 
  • PTE             :          55 with minimum scores of 51 in each component

Aberystwyth University The Average Tuition Fees And Other Expenses

Cost Amount per annum (GBP)
Tuition fees 13,600 – 16,800
Food, Laundry & Toiletries 1,800
Books, Equipment & Stationery 150
Social 1,170
Clothing 200
Travel Home 200
T.V. Licence 150.50
Extras 400
Total 17,670.5 – 20,870.5
